WebOption 1: Enroll in a Marketplace plan If you leave your job for any reason (even if you quit or get fired) and lose your job-based health insurance, you can enroll in a Marketplace plan. You’ll qualify for a Special Enrollment Period to enroll to get coverage for the rest of the year. When you lose your job, you may be entitled to final payments. Check your contract or ask your employer if you're entitled to redundancy or retrenchment payments, or annual leave and long service payouts.
